Systematic review and meta‐analysis: efficacy and safety of early biologic treatment in adult and paediatric patients with Crohn’s disease

摘要

Summary Background There is an increasing body of evidence showing that earlier use of biologics improves clinical outcomes in Crohn's disease (CD). Aim To perform a systematic review and meta‐analysis to assess the impact of early biologic use in the treatment of CD. Methods PubMed and Embase databases were searched for English language papers and conference abstracts published through April 30, 2019. Studies were selected for inclusion if patients initiated biologics within 2 years of a CD diagnosis or if earlier biologics use (top‐down) was compared with a conventional step‐up strategy. Random‐effects meta‐analyses were conducted to compare clinical remission (CR), relapse and endoscopic healing rates between early biologic treatment (<2 years of disease duration or top‐down treatment strategy) and late/conventional treatment (biologic use after >2 years of disease duration or conventional step‐up treatment strategy). Results A total of 3069 records were identified, of which 47 references met the selection criteria for systematic review. A total of 18 471 patients were studied, with a median follow‐up of 64 weeks (range 10‐416). Meta‐analysis found that early use of biologics was associated with higher rates of clinical remission (OR 2.10 [95% CI: 1.69‐2.60], n = 2763, P < .00001), lower relapse rates (OR 0.31 [95% CI: 0.14‐0.68], n = 596, P = .003) and higher mucosal healing rates (OR 2.37 [95% CI: 1.78‐3.16], n = 994, P < .00001) compared with late/conventional management. Conclusions Early biologic treatment is associated with improved clinical outcomes in both adult and paediatric CD patients, not only in prospective clinical trials but also in real‐world settings.
